  5. Sponsored posts — posts you are paid to write. Product placement — similar to sponsored posts, payment for inclusion and links in your posts. Services offered – training, speaking, stock photos, tour guiding — supported by your blog posts. Online store - sell your own product, physical or digital. Contests – money or information in exchange for chance to win products or services from you or a sponsor
  6. Affiliates – one of the best ways to monetize. Great for sprinkling into posts. For items in the 3 digit range, affiliate sales can really add up! Pay per Click - Google Adsense ads connected through code placed on your site. The more clicks, the more money, pennies at a time. Lead Generation - similar to affiliates but without the purchase. All your reader has to do is submit an email or phone number for you to get paid. Advertising – static or rotating ads can be placed in your headers, sidebars, footers — or more annoyingly — in your posts. These could be affiliate or flat-rate ads. Directory – Advertisers pay you more for extended listings and perhaps sponsored posts. With a built-in market, you will have endless topics to write about. Subscriptions –This method works best when you are an influencer first. Membership – similar to selling subscriptions, you form a group who will pay dues to get and share exclusive offers and information.
